Best Schools for Biomedical Engineering in Arizona
Below are the schools that deliver the strongest overall biomedical engineering education in Arizona.
Top Schools in Biomedical Engineering
Our analysis ranked University Of Arizona the best school in the country for a degree in biomedical engineering. Set in the city of Tucson, University Of Arizona is a very large public institution. The six-year graduation rate is 68%. About 79 biomedical engineering degrees were awarded at University Of Arizona in the most recent year. Students who receive their biomedical engineering degree from University Of Arizona earn around $50,834 in the first couple years of their career. Students borrow a median of $23,000 to complete this degree.

Arizona State University came in at #2 on our 2026 list of the best biomedical engineering schools. This very large public university is located in the city of Tempe. Arizona State University graduates 68% of students within six years. There were roughly 204 biomedical engineering students who graduated with this degree at Arizona State University in the most recent data year. Soon after graduation, biomedical engineering degree recipients from Arizona State University generally make around $69,176. Students borrow a median of $21,429 to complete this degree.

Grand Canyon University came in at #3 on our 2026 list of the best biomedical engineering schools. This very large private for-profit university is located in the city of Phoenix. About 44% of students finish within six years. Grand Canyon University awarded about 21 biomedical engineering degrees in the most recent data year. Biomedical Engineering graduates of Grand Canyon University earn a median of $56,285 early in their careers. Students borrow a median of $30,027 to complete this degree.

Notes and References
This list is compiled by College Factual (MF_RANKING_2025), 2026 edition. The methodology weighs graduation rate, post-graduation earnings, cost, and program quality, drawn primarily from the U.S. Department of Education (IPEDS and College Scorecard).
Ranking method: College Major Top Ranked · 4 schools evaluated.
- The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), a branch of the U.S. Department of Education (DOE), serves as the core of our data about colleges.
- Some other college data, including much of the graduate earnings data, comes from the U.S. Department of Education’s (College Scorecard).
